    • 425 lever outside access devices

      Exidor easy and convenient lever outside access device for use with 400 series hardware, available with or without a Euro cylinder. Key retention model available (Suffix order code with “RK” for key retention). Helps meet BS 8300 requirements for barrier-free access. Excellent for high-traffic areas like staff or goods-in entrances to a factory or industrial environment. The unit is operated by pushing the lever down retracts the internal bolts/latches, releasing the lever returns the internal bolts/latches to the rest position. Certified as an approved accessory to the 400 series as part of EN 1125 and EN 179. Indicate the required finish when ordering (plated finishes are not recommended for external use). Additional fixings for thicker doors are available on request.
    • 426 Knob outside access device

      Exidor fresh and modern t-bar knob operated outside access device for use with 400 series hardware, for gaining entry through an escape door. The unit is operated by rotating the knob to retract the internal bolts/latches, releasing the knob returns the internal bolts/latches to the rest position. T-bar knob unit is compact in shape and unlikely to catch users as they pass by. Available with or without a Euro cylinder as well as offering key retention options. Locking the cylinder prevents access into the building but will not prevent escape from the building. Certified as an approved accessory to 400 series hardware as part of EN 1125.  
    • 400 & 401 Touch bar panic latch

      Exidor single point locking touch bar panic latch with a sleek design combined with smooth operation to give a solution ideal for use in front of the house or other public areas. The unit is operated by pressing the bar into the door face retracting the latch bolt and releasing the bar returning the latch bolt to the rest position. The touch bar is available in two standard sizes to suit doors up to 900mm or 1200mm wide (Bar widths are set sizes with other sizes available on request). Microswitch, alarm, and holdback dogging options are available but note dogging (holdback) variants are not suitable for fire doors. Certified in compliance with EN 1125 and suitable for timber doors up to FD120 and FD120/FD240 metal doors.

      Exidor touch bar panic mortice actuator supplied with/without Euro profile cylinder lock, ideal for low traffic doors in public areas such as schools or healthcare premises requiring key entry only. The unit is operated by pressing the bar into the door face retracting the mortice lock latch and releasing the bar returning the mortice lock latch to the rest position. Two standard sizes to suit doors up to 900mm (420 model) or 1200mm (421 model) wide. Microswitch and alarm options available. Certified in compliance with EN 1125.
    • 421 wide touch bar panic mortice nightlatch

      The Exidor 421 offer a touch bar actuator unit with a cylinder mortice nightlatch case that can be supplied with or without a Euro profile cylinder for access from the outside. A mortice plate is supplied as standard. The unit is suitable for wooden or steel, single and double applications and provides security on the outside with ease of escape from the inside in panic situations.
